Project

General

Profile

Feature #1581

Upgrade Bootstrap to 5

Added by Alexander Watzinger about 1 year ago. Updated 5 months ago.

Status:
Closed
Priority:
Normal
Category:
UI
Target version:
Start date:
2021-09-19
Estimated time:

Description

Overall this should not require any major changes, however some minor breaking changes may affect us:

Related issues

Precedes Feature #1690: Forms: add types dynamicallyClosed2021-09-20Actions
Precedes Feature #1721: Improved focus behaviour at formsClosed2021-09-20Actions

History

#1

Updated by Alexander Watzinger about 1 year ago

  • Description updated (diff)
#2

Updated by Christoph Hoffmann about 1 year ago

  • Description updated (diff)
#3

Updated by Alexander Watzinger about 1 year ago

  • Description updated (diff)

By the way, there is already a branch feature_bullseye for the new Debian packages (#1566) which needs also new stuff for API swagger so take a look at installation or upgrade notes there.
I merge our develop branch regular to feature_bullseye to keep it up to date with current development.
So best strategy would be to make a new branch from feature_bullseye and merge feature_bullseye from time to time to your new branch.

#4

Updated by Alexander Watzinger 9 months ago

  • Target version changed from 7.0.0 to 7.1.0
#5

Updated by Alexander Watzinger 9 months ago

#6

Updated by Alexander Watzinger 8 months ago

  • Target version changed from 7.1.0 to 7.3.0
#7

Updated by Alexander Watzinger 7 months ago

  • Status changed from Assigned to Acknowledged
  • Assignee deleted (Christoph Hoffmann)
  • Target version changed from 7.3.0 to Wishlist
#8

Updated by Alexander Watzinger 7 months ago

#9

Updated by Alexander Watzinger 6 months ago

  • Description updated (diff)
  • Status changed from Acknowledged to Assigned
  • Assignee set to Andreas Olschnögger
  • Target version changed from Wishlist to 7.3.0

Because upgrading Bootstrap is a prerequisite for all new frontend features I assigned Andi and moved this from the wishlist to the next release.

#10

Updated by Alexander Watzinger 6 months ago

#11

Updated by Bernhard Koschiček-Krombholz 5 months ago

  • Target version changed from 7.3.0 to 7.4.0
#12

Updated by Alexander Watzinger 5 months ago

@Andi: while you are at it, I would kindly ask if you could look into layout issues of

1) CIDOC class view: 2) Property view:

Both are very simple templates but they are not responsive when viewed with a smaller screen size. I guess the fix is quite easy but didn't want to interfere with the Bootstrap upgrade.

#13

Updated by Alexander Watzinger 5 months ago

  • Precedes Feature #1721: Improved focus behaviour at forms added
#14

Updated by Alexander Watzinger 5 months ago

  • Status changed from Assigned to Closed

Thanks a lot Andi for implementing, I tested a little: it looks good, feels quite faster and I haven't encountered any issues so far.
Although we still have to test it in more detail I'm closing this ticket and create an issue for the class/property views.

New code is in the develop branch, for updating the NPM packages take a look at the upgrade notes.

Also available in: Atom PDF